Willing to be Willing is the story of a few years in the life of Ken Reeves and Johna Gibbens Rickman Reeves. The story unfolds in a drug rehabilitation center and moves through 14 months of federal prison to the discovery of HIV/AIDS diagnosis. The many characters of this book reveal the consequences of using drugs, being promiscous and simply living only for the moment. The decisions made by Ken Reeves inspire hope, willingness and choices that benefit others.
